From 93260ea36fa5493e39d7948038f387adde4cd62d Mon Sep 17 00:00:00 2001 From: Mathieu Jaumotte Date: Mon, 26 Apr 2021 11:46:59 +0200 Subject: [PATCH] move AccompanyingCourse component in his own directory --- .../App.vue} | 20 +++----------- .../components/AccompanyingCourse.vue | 26 +++++++++++++++++++ .../components/PersonItem.vue} | 2 +- .../components/PersonsAssociated.vue | 17 +++++++++--- .../components/Requestor.vue | 6 +---- .../public/js/AccompanyingCourse/index.js | 8 ++++++ .../public/js/AccompanyingCourse/store/.keep | 0 .../Resources/public/js/index.js | 9 ------- .../views/AccompanyingCourse/show.html.twig | 2 +- .../ChillPersonBundle/chill.webpack.config.js | 2 +- 10 files changed, 55 insertions(+), 37 deletions(-) rename src/Bundle/ChillPersonBundle/Resources/public/js/{AccompanyingCourse.vue => AccompanyingCourse/App.vue} (63%) create mode 100644 src/Bundle/ChillPersonBundle/Resources/public/js/AccompanyingCourse/components/AccompanyingCourse.vue rename src/Bundle/ChillPersonBundle/Resources/public/js/{components/PersonAction.vue => AccompanyingCourse/components/PersonItem.vue} (95%) rename src/Bundle/ChillPersonBundle/Resources/public/js/{ => AccompanyingCourse}/components/PersonsAssociated.vue (80%) rename src/Bundle/ChillPersonBundle/Resources/public/js/{ => AccompanyingCourse}/components/Requestor.vue (75%) create mode 100644 src/Bundle/ChillPersonBundle/Resources/public/js/AccompanyingCourse/index.js create mode 100644 src/Bundle/ChillPersonBundle/Resources/public/js/AccompanyingCourse/store/.keep delete mode 100644 src/Bundle/ChillPersonBundle/Resources/public/js/index.js diff --git a/src/Bundle/ChillPersonBundle/Resources/public/js/AccompanyingCourse.vue b/src/Bundle/ChillPersonBundle/Resources/public/js/AccompanyingCourse/App.vue similarity index 63% rename from src/Bundle/ChillPersonBundle/Resources/public/js/AccompanyingCourse.vue rename to src/Bundle/ChillPersonBundle/Resources/public/js/AccompanyingCourse/App.vue index 2b7c4f604..971eca1c7 100644 --- a/src/Bundle/ChillPersonBundle/Resources/public/js/AccompanyingCourse.vue +++ b/src/Bundle/ChillPersonBundle/Resources/public/js/AccompanyingCourse/App.vue @@ -1,30 +1,18 @@ diff --git a/src/Bundle/ChillPersonBundle/Resources/public/js/components/PersonAction.vue b/src/Bundle/ChillPersonBundle/Resources/public/js/AccompanyingCourse/components/PersonItem.vue similarity index 95% rename from src/Bundle/ChillPersonBundle/Resources/public/js/components/PersonAction.vue rename to src/Bundle/ChillPersonBundle/Resources/public/js/AccompanyingCourse/components/PersonItem.vue index be356895c..f75f0779b 100644 --- a/src/Bundle/ChillPersonBundle/Resources/public/js/components/PersonAction.vue +++ b/src/Bundle/ChillPersonBundle/Resources/public/js/AccompanyingCourse/components/PersonItem.vue @@ -16,7 +16,7 @@ diff --git a/src/Bundle/ChillPersonBundle/Resources/public/js/AccompanyingCourse/index.js b/src/Bundle/ChillPersonBundle/Resources/public/js/AccompanyingCourse/index.js new file mode 100644 index 000000000..4335113f7 --- /dev/null +++ b/src/Bundle/ChillPersonBundle/Resources/public/js/AccompanyingCourse/index.js @@ -0,0 +1,8 @@ +import App from './App.vue'; +import { createApp } from 'vue'; + +const app = createApp({ + template: `` +}) +.component('app', App) +.mount('#accompanying-course'); diff --git a/src/Bundle/ChillPersonBundle/Resources/public/js/AccompanyingCourse/store/.keep b/src/Bundle/ChillPersonBundle/Resources/public/js/AccompanyingCourse/store/.keep new file mode 100644 index 000000000..e69de29bb diff --git a/src/Bundle/ChillPersonBundle/Resources/public/js/index.js b/src/Bundle/ChillPersonBundle/Resources/public/js/index.js deleted file mode 100644 index c10f555f3..000000000 --- a/src/Bundle/ChillPersonBundle/Resources/public/js/index.js +++ /dev/null @@ -1,9 +0,0 @@ -import AccompanyingCourse from './AccompanyingCourse.vue'; -import { createApp } from 'vue'; - -const app = createApp({ - name: 'App', - template: `` -}) -.component('accompanying-course', AccompanyingCourse) -.mount('#app'); diff --git a/src/Bundle/ChillPersonBundle/Resources/views/AccompanyingCourse/show.html.twig b/src/Bundle/ChillPersonBundle/Resources/views/AccompanyingCourse/show.html.twig index 87017bbc1..a33b65cff 100644 --- a/src/Bundle/ChillPersonBundle/Resources/views/AccompanyingCourse/show.html.twig +++ b/src/Bundle/ChillPersonBundle/Resources/views/AccompanyingCourse/show.html.twig @@ -8,7 +8,7 @@

{{ block('title') }}

-
+
{{ encore_entry_script_tags('accompanying_course') }} diff --git a/src/Bundle/ChillPersonBundle/chill.webpack.config.js b/src/Bundle/ChillPersonBundle/chill.webpack.config.js index 69be65e92..9d7a33d02 100644 --- a/src/Bundle/ChillPersonBundle/chill.webpack.config.js +++ b/src/Bundle/ChillPersonBundle/chill.webpack.config.js @@ -8,5 +8,5 @@ module.exports = function(encore, entries) ChillPersonAssets: __dirname + '/Resources/public' }); - encore.addEntry('accompanying_course', __dirname + '/Resources/public/js/index.js'); + encore.addEntry('accompanying_course', __dirname + '/Resources/public/js/AccompanyingCourse/index.js'); };